Vampire The Masquerade - Bloodlines

I realize this game came out 3 years ago, but there is no thread on this OMG UNBELIEVABLY AWESOME game. I've picked it up recently because I had a conversation about the downfall of adventure type games in the last, oh 10 years? And this was recommended as something close enough to adventure while also being an extremly good game.

This game has probably the most hilarious dialogue ever, plus a truckload of cultural references. My first laugh? A computer store named "Megahurtz"

The game also is damn intense on the whole storyline as well and the spellcasting is unbelievably awesome, at least as a Tremere (Wizard Vampire?).
They have mind control, but better! Not only does the target fight for you for a while, it will die of cardiac arrest instead of turning back on you!
And unlike D&D games, the KILL spells actually KILL people. Remember the Blade Trinity blood explosion thing Blade uses at the end? It's in the game too!

If you're looking for decent horror-adventure, you should give this a try. Should be in the bargain bin by now.

Oh, it's also by far the most violent and disturbing game I've ever played.

Yes, it was great, as far as RPGs go. It was waaaaaay buggy on release. It's since had a shitton of player-made patches.

I suggest you get them if you haven't, the fanbase fixed nearly everything and enhanced the game.

It's easily one of the best computer RPG games ever.

It has a whole different dialog set if you play as the crazy vampires, too. (Malkavians.)
